Mediocre, not the best VBT offers
Having been on many VBT trips, this one didn't quite measure up. Two problems: 1) the E- bike was very heavy and as a small woman was difficult to manage and get on and off. You do need an E-bike though as many long hills. Number 2 was Portugal itself. There wasn't much to see or do in comparison to other European trips, esp. the bike and barge trips. Here, no cute towns to explore and for the first 4 days the scenery was mostly uninspiring. Also, difficult logistics catching the river boat.The guides and boat were excellent but couldn't compensate for a trip with little off-road interest.

Douro River Cruise and Biking Tour
We enjoyed cycling through the Douro River region and seeing the charming villages. The arranged lunches at local restaurants were a highlight. The recent fires in the area did take away from some of the natural beauty, but despite that, we had fun cycling. There are plenty of lovely views to enjoy. Our trip leaders did a great job. The terrain is quite hilly, - be prepared! Cruising on the Douro added to the experience.

Our Guides Made this Trip Especially Memorable...
Our Guides, Alberto and Pol, made this trip one to remember! Surprises at every bend on the Camino. We especially enjoyed the Northern Coastal areas and the Vineyards (Ribera Sacra) in the mountains overlooking the Sil River. But the cultural experiences really made the trip POP! From the Queimada demonstration to the Pottery making demo at Rectoral de Gundivos, to the Good Shepherd Demo, and did we mention the Paradores! Overall, a great sampler of the Camino, and one we hope to revisit as Pilgrims. Wish we could have spent more time hiking the Camino and less time on the charter bus, but we understand the limitations. Perhaps CW will extend this trip by a few days down the road (path).
